PASTRAMI: Privacy-preserving, Auditable, Scalable & Trustworthy Auctions for Multiple Items

Krol, Michal;Sonnino, Alberto;Tasiopoulos, Argyrios;Psaras, Ioannis;Riviere, Etienne
(2020) ACM/IFIP Middleware conference — Location: Delft, the Netherlands

Files

auctions.pdf
  • Open Access
  • Adobe PDF
  • 3.25 MB

Details

Authors
  • Krol, MichalUCLouvain
    Author
  • Sonnino, AlbertoUniversity College London
    Author
  • Tasiopoulos, ArgyriosUniversity College London
    Author
  • Psaras, IoannisProtocol Labs and University College London
    Author
  • Author
Abstract
Decentralised cloud computing platforms enable individuals to offer and rent resources in a peer-to-peer fashion. They must assign resources from multiple sellers to multiple buyers and derive prices that match the interests and capacities of both parties. The assignment process must be decentralised, fair and transparent, but also protect the privacy of buyers. We present PASTRAMI, a decentralised platform enabling trustworthy assignments of items and prices between a large number of sellers and bidders, through the support of multi-item auctions. PASTRAMI uses threshold blind signatures and commitment schemes to provide strong privacy guarantees while making bidders accountable. It leverages the Ethereum blockchain for auditability, combining efficient off-chain computations with novel, on-chain proofs of misbehavior. Our evaluation of PASTRAMI using Filecoin workloads show its ability to efficiently produce trustworthy assignments between thousands of buyers and sellers.
Affiliations

Citations

Krol, M., Sonnino, A., Tasiopoulos, A., Psaras, I., & Riviere, E. (2020). PASTRAMI: Privacy-preserving, Auditable, Scalable & Trustworthy Auctions for Multiple Items. Proceedings of the 21st Annual Middleware Conference. Published. ACM/IFIP Middleware conference, Delft, the Netherlands. https://doi.org/10.1145/3423211.3425669